Imports OfficeOpenXml
Imports OfficeOpenXml.ThreadedComments
Imports System
Imports System.Drawing
Namespace EPPlusSamples.WorkbookWorksheetAndRanges
Public Module CommentsSample
Public Sub Run()
Console.WriteLine("Running sample 1.5-Comments/Notes and Threaded Comments")
Using package = New ExcelPackage()
' Comments/Notes
Dim sheet1 = package.Workbook.Worksheets.Add("Comments")
AddComments(sheet1)
' Threaded comments
Dim sheet2 = package.Workbook.Worksheets.Add("ThreadedComments")
AddAndReadThreadedComments(sheet2)
package.SaveAs(FileUtil.GetCleanFileInfo("1.05-Comments.xlsx"))
End Using
Console.WriteLine("Sample 1.5 created {0}", FileUtil.OutputDir.Name)
Console.WriteLine()
End Sub
Private Sub AddComments(ByVal ws As ExcelWorksheet)
Console.WriteLine("Sample 1.5 - Comment/Note")
'Add Comments using the range class
Dim comment = ws.Cells("A3").AddComment("Jan Källman:" & vbCrLf, "JK")
comment.Font.Bold = True
Dim rt = comment.RichText.Add("This column contains the extensions.")
rt.Bold = False
comment.AutoFit = True
'Add a comment using the Comment collection
comment = ws.Comments.Add(ws.Cells("B3"), "This column contains the size of the files.", "JK")
'This sets the size and position. (The position is only when the comment is visible)
comment.From.Column = 7
comment.From.Row = 3
comment.To.Column = 16
comment.To.Row = 8
comment.BackgroundColor = Color.White
comment.RichText.Add(vbCrLf & "To format the numbers use the Numberformat-property like:" & vbCrLf)
ws.Cells("B3:B42").Style.Numberformat.Format = "#,##0"
'Format the code using the RichText Collection
Dim rc = comment.RichText.Add("//Format the Size and Count column" & vbCrLf)
rc.FontName = "Courier New"
rc.Color = Color.FromArgb(0, 128, 0)
rc = comment.RichText.Add("ws.Cells[")
rc.Color = Color.Black
rc = comment.RichText.Add("""B3:B42""")
rc.Color = Color.FromArgb(123, 21, 21)
rc = comment.RichText.Add("].Style.Numberformat.Format = ")
rc.Color = Color.Black
rc = comment.RichText.Add("""#,##0""")
rc.Color = Color.FromArgb(123, 21, 21)
rc = comment.RichText.Add(";")
rc.Color = Color.Black
Console.WriteLine("Comment added")
Console.WriteLine()
End Sub
Private Sub AddAndReadThreadedComments(ByVal sheet As ExcelWorksheet)
Dim persons = sheet.ThreadedComments.Persons
' Add a threaded comment author
Dim user1 = persons.Add("Ernest Peter Plus")
' add a threaded comment to cell A1
Dim thread = sheet.Cells("A1").AddThreadedComment()
thread.AddComment(user1.Id, "My first comment")
' threaded comments can also be added via the worksheet:
thread.AddComment(user1.Id, "My second comment")
' A workbook might have been opened by previous users that you will find in the ThreadedComments collection, could be from the AD and/or Office365.
' Let's add another fictive user using the user id format of Office365.
Dim user2 = persons.Add("John Doe", "S::john.doe@somecompany.com::e3e726c6-1401-473b-bc95-cb3e1c892d99", IdentityProvider.Office365)
' The Thread.Sleep(50) statements below is just to avoid that comments get the same timestamp when this sample runs
Threading.Thread.Sleep(50)
' now we can add comments with mentions
thread.AddComment(user2.Id, "Really great comments there, {0}", user1)
Threading.Thread.Sleep(50)
thread.AddComment(user1.Id, "Many thanks {0}!", user2)
' A third person joins
Dim user3 = persons.Add("IT Support")
' you can add multiple mentions in one comment like this
Threading.Thread.Sleep(50)
thread.AddComment(user3.Id, "Hello {0} and {1}, how can I help?", user1, user2)
Console.WriteLine("*** reading threaded comments ***")
' Read threaded comments in a cell:
For Each comment In sheet.Cells("A1").ThreadedComment.Comments
Dim author = persons(comment.PersonId)
Console.WriteLine("{0} wrote at {1}", author.DisplayName, comment.DateCreated.ToString())
Console.WriteLine(comment.Text)
If comment.Mentions IsNot Nothing Then
For Each mention In comment.Mentions
Dim personMentioned = persons(mention.MentionPersonId)
Console.WriteLine("{0} was mentioned in a comment", personMentioned.DisplayName)
Console.WriteLine("Identity provider: {0}", personMentioned.ProviderId.ToString())
Next
End If
Console.WriteLine("***************************")
Next
' finally close the thread (can be opened again with the ReopenThread method)
thread.ResolveThread()
If thread.IsResolved Then
Console.WriteLine("The thread is now resolved!")
End If
' for backward compatibility a comment/note is created in a cell containing a threaded comment
' if threaded comments is not supported the user will see this comment instead
Dim legacyComment = sheet.Cells("A1").Comment
Console.WriteLine("Legacy comment text: {0}", legacyComment.Text)
' add a thread in cell B1, add a comment
Dim thread2 = sheet.ThreadedComments.Add("B1")
Dim c = thread2.AddComment(user1.Id, "Hello")
Console.WriteLine("B1 now contains a thread with {0} comment", thread2.Comments.Count)
' remove the comment
thread2.Remove(c)
If thread2.Comments.Count = 0 Then Console.WriteLine("Thread is now empty")
End Sub
End Module
End Namespace
